WeBrokr is excited to announce that TheMarySue.com has been successfully acquired by GAMURS Group. The Mary Sue was founded by Dan Abrams in 2011, and is known as the Geek Girls Guide to the Universe! Having published over 70,000 unique articles, The Mary Sue has grown from a small upstart blog, to one of the most well known publications in the entertainment industry.

This successful Sell-Side brokerage representation of The Mary Sue marks WeBrokr’s second major entertainment publishing acquisition of 2021, after the successful sale of We Got This Covered to GAMURS Group earlier in the year.

“As GAMURS Group reaches a pivotal stage of growth with continued expansion, we are doubling down on our commitment to create world class gaming and entertainment content. That’s what makes The Mary Sue such an extremely appealing addition to our website portfolio,” says Riad Chikhani, Founder and CEO of the GAMURS Group. “The Mary Sue is committed to quality journalism and commentary for a geek culture audience with interests that span social media, technology, arts, and politics. We are proud to bring it into our network and to continue its growth.”

“The Mary Sue has provided an important and sometimes ignored voice that I am so proud to have helped support,” said Dan Abrams, publisher of The Mary Sue. “This next step will allow it to expand to new levels and share its message with a larger audience.”

WeBrokr is pleased to announce that WeGotThisCovered.com has been successfully acquired by GAMURS Group. We Got This Covered, also known as WGTC, was founded by Matt Joseph in 2010 as a college passion-project. WGTC has grown exponentially over the years to become one of the leading entertainment properties in the world, bringing in over 16 million Sessions in May 2021.

GAMURS Group CEO Riad Chikhani says the acquisition serves as a major stepping stone for the company’s goal of redefining gaming and entertainment media.

“Gaming, TV, and film entertainment continue to become increasingly intertwined. We see, for example, Thanos skins in Fortnite, esports events reaching more broadcast channels, and countless other developments. By adding We Got This Covered to our media portfolio, it affords us the opportunity to not simply cover this growing intersection of gaming and entertainment from the lens of gaming, but from the lens of culture, TV, and film,” Chikhani said.
